One of the smaller parks, we saw lots of elephants, lion, eagle, giraffes, zebras, antelopes, monkeys, different birds. It is a mix of the beautiful baobab trees and bushes. Nice picnic area, relatively close to Arusha.

The scenery is very varied, undulating, dramatic, barren, verdant. Plenty of wildlife. The Maasai are fascinating and their herds of cattle, goats or donkeys become a familiar part of the landscape.

Tarangire National Park felt smaller than the other two. Maybe it was. It was our first day so we didn't know that this park was smaller, so this did not affect my day at all. This park has many animals as well. Because of the size, we saw animals much more often and saw them pretty closely.
